一、诊断空间占用情况
使用df -h
命令可快速查看各分区使用率,重点关注系统根目录(/)和临时文件夹(/tmp)的占用比例。在VMware等平台可通过虚拟机设置界面查看磁盘分配状态,宿主机剩余空间不足时会出现黄色警告标志。
二、清理无用数据
执行以下标准化清理流程:
- 删除日志与缓存:
sudo apt-get clean && sudo rm -rf /var/log/*.gz
- 查找大文件:
sudo du -ah / | sort -n -r | head -n 20
- 卸载冗余软件包:
sudo apt autoremove --purge
建议定期使用ncdu
工具进行可视化空间分析,特别是检查/var/lib/docker等容器存储目录。
三、扩展磁盘空间
主流虚拟化平台扩容步骤:
- VMware:关闭虚拟机→编辑设置→硬盘→扩展→输入新容量(建议单次扩展不超过原大小200%)
- VirtualBox:使用
VBoxManage modifyhd
命令动态调整,需启用VDI格式的resize特性
四、调整文件系统
完成物理扩容后需进行分区调整:
- 安装gparted工具:
sudo apt install gparted
- 卸载目标分区:
sudo umount /dev/sdaX
- 使用图形工具扩展分区,注意保留至少1GB未分配空间用于应急恢复
五、预防性维护策略
建立定期维护机制:
- 设置磁盘使用率监控告警(推荐阈值85%)
- 启用logrotate自动压缩历史日志
- 为Docker等容器服务配置存储驱动限制
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/695822.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。